BARRATT is opening the books on a selection of new properties off-plan at its Charlton Hayes development in Filton. Potential buyers can register their interest now ahead of the official launch of the two, three and four-bedroom homes.

On the northern outskirts of Bristol, the development will offer easy access to the city centre, motorway and rail networks.
